Section 26

of Electricity Act 2001

Section 26

Determination of disputes by Authority

(1)

Any dispute between a consumer and a market support services licensee as to whether supply of electricity should be provided to that consumer —

(a)

may be referred to the Authority by either party; and

(b)

on such a reference, is to be determined by the Authority, whose decision is final and conclusive between the parties.

(2)

Notwithstanding that a dispute between a consumer and a market support services licensee has been referred to the Authority, the licensee must, subject to sections 21(3) and 41(13), supply electricity to the consumer until the dispute is determined by the Authority.
